LanzaJet inks deal with British Airways for 7,500 tons of low-emission fuel additive per year

LanzaJet, the renewable jet fuel startup spun out from the longtime renewable and synthetic fuel manufacturer LanzaTech, has inked a supply agreement with British Airways to supply the company with at least 7,500 tons of fuel additive per year.

The deal marks the second agreement between the U.K.-based airline and a renewable jet fuels manufacturer following an August 2019 agreement with the British company Velocys. It’s also LanzaJet’s second offtake agreement. The company announced itself with a partnership between the renewable fuels manufacturer and the Japanese airline ANA.

Through the deal, British Airways will invest an undisclosed amount in LanzaJet’s first commercial scale facility in Georgia. The fuel will begin powering flights by the end of 2022, the companies said.

It’s part of a broader expansion effort that could see LanzaJet establish a commercial facility for the U.K. airline in its home country in the coming years.

Back in the U.S. the plan is to begin construction on the Georgia facility later this year, which will convert ethanol into a jet fuel additive using a chemical process.

Fuel from the plant will reduce the overall greenhouse emissions by 70% versus traditional jet fuel. It’s the equivalent of taking almost 27,000 gasoline or diesel-powered cars off the road each year, according to the company.

The deal is the culmination of years of research and development work between LanzaJet’s parent company, LanzaTech, and Department of Energy’s Pacific Northwest National Laboratory.

Spun off in June 2020, LanzaJet was financed by an investment group including parent company LanzaTech, Mitsui, and Suncor Energy. British Airways now joins the two other strategic investors as LanzaJet eyes an ambitious scale-up program through 2025. The company plans to launch four large-scale plants producing a pipeline of renewable fuels. 

“Low-cost, sustainable fuel options are critical for the future of the aviation sector and the LanzaJet process offers the most flexible feedstock solution at scale, recycling wastes and residues into SAF that allows us to keep fossil jet fuel in the ground. British Airways has long been a  champion of waste to fuels pathways especially with the UK Government,” said Jimmy Samartzis, the chief executive of LanzaJet. “With the right support for waste-based fuels, the UK would be an ideal location for commercial scale LanzaJet plants. We look forward to continuing the dialogue with BA and the UK Government in making this a reality, and to  continuing our support of bringing the Prime Minister’s Jet Zero vision to life.”  

The LanzaJet fuel is certified for commercial flight up to 50% blend with conventional kerosene. “Considering the aviation market is 90 billion gallons of jet fuel a year, having 50% or 45 billion of production capacity and reaching that max blend level will be a great problem to have,” said LanzaTech chief executive Jennifer Holmgren in an email.

LanzaJet’s manufacturing facility in Georgia is designed to produce zero-waste fuels, according to Holmgren, and British Airways will receive 7,500 tons of sustainable aviation fuel from LanzaJet’s biorefinery each year for the next five years.

The partnership is between British Airways, Hangar 51 (International Airlines Group’s accelerator) and others.

In addition to its biofuel work, British Airways is also working with companies like ZeroAvia, the hydrogen fuels company that also received backing from Amazon, Shell and Breakthrough Energy Ventures.

“For  the last 100 years we have connected Britain with the world and the world with Britain, and to ensure our success for the next 100, we must do this sustainably,” said British Airways chief executive Sean Doyle. 

“Progressing the development and commercial deployment of sustainable aviation fuel is crucial to  decarbonising the aviation industry and this partnership with LanzaJet shows the progress British Airways is making as we continue on our journey to net zero.”

Health tech startup Bold raises $7 million in seed funding for senior-focused fitness programs

Virtual health and wellness platforms have grown increasingly popular throughout the pandemic, but a new startup wants to focus that effort exclusively on senior citizens. Bold, a digital health and wellness service, plans to prevent chronic health problems in older adults through free and personalized exercise programs. Co-founded by Amanda Rees and her partner Hari Arul, Bold picked up $7 million this week in seed funding led by Julie Yoo of Silicon Valley-based Andreessen Horowitz.

Rees said in an interview that the idea for Bold came from time she spent caring for her grandmother, helping her through health challenges like falls. “I kept thinking about solutions we could build to keep someone healthier longer, rather than waiting for until they have a fall or something else goes off the rails to intervene,” she said. Rees started Bold to use what she’d learned from her own experience in dance and yoga to help her grandmother practice maintaining balance to prevent future falls. “My passion really was around ways to sort of widen the aperture and make these solutions more accessible and built for older people.”

The member experience is pretty straightforward. Users fill out some brief fitness information on the web-based platform, outlining their goals and current baseline. From that information, Bold creates a personalized program that ranges from a short, seated Tai Chi class once a week, to cardio and strength classes meeting multiple times each week. “The idea is to really meet a member where they are, and then through our programming, help them along their journey of doing the types of exercises that are going to have the most immediate benefit for them,” said Rees.

Bold’s funding round comes at a time of concern around ballooning healthcare expenses for older populations, and a focus on how to reduce these costs for both current and future generations. While falls alone aren’t necessarily complex medical incidents, they have the potential to lead to fractures and other serious injuries. Bold’s preventative approach to falls is a more active solution than necklace or bracelet monitors that send a signal to emergency services when they detect a fall. And by offering virtual programs, they can help at-risk older populations engage in exercise while avoiding potential COVID-19 exposure at gyms.

Research shows that this works. Even simple, low-intensity exercise can improve balance and strength enough to reduce the incidence of falls, which is currently the leading cause of injury and injury death among older adults.

Fewer injuries would mean less need for medical care, which would lead to money saved for hospitals and health insurers alike. That’s why in addition to their seed funding, Bold has plans to start rolling out partnerships with Medicare Advantage organizations and risk-bearing providers, which will help make their exercise programs available to users for free.

Everlywell raises $175 million to expand virtual care options and scale its at-home health testing

Digital health startup Everlywell has raised a $175 million Series D funding round, following relatively fast on the heels of a $25 million Series C round it closed in February of this year. The Series D included a host of new investors, including BlackRock, The Chernin Group (TCG), Foresite Capital, Greenspring Associates, Morningside Ventures and Portfolio, along with existing investors including Highland Capital Partners, which led the Series C round. The startup has now raised more than $250 million to date.

Everlywell, which launched to the public at TechCrunch Disrupt SF 2016 as a participant in Startup Battlefield, specializes in home healthcare, and specifically on home healthcare tests supported by their digital platform for providing customers with their results and helping them understand the diagnostics, and how to seek the right follow-on care and expert medical advice.

Earlier this year, Everlywell launched an at-home COVID-19 test collection kit — the first of this type of test to receive an emergency authorization from the U.S. Food and Drug Administration (FDA) for its use that allowed cooperation with multiple lab service providers over time. The COVID-19 test kit joins its many other offerings, which include tests for thyroid hormone levels, food and allergen sensitivity, women’s health and fertility, vitamin D deficiency and more. I spoke to Everlywell CEO and founder Julia Cheek about the raise, and she acknowledged that the COVID-19 pandemic was definitely behind the decision to raise such a large amount so quickly again after the close of the Series C, since the company saw a sharp increase in demand coming out of the coronavirus crisis — not only for its COVID-19 test kit, but for at-home digital healthcare options in general.

“We obviously have a very successful COVID-19 test,” she said. “But we’ve also seen three-fourths of our test menu just explode at well over 100% year-over-year growth, and several of our tests are at 4x or 5x growth. That is really representative of this shift in consumer health behavior that will continue in a big way in many different verticals that include testing, and making things more convenient, digitally-enabled, and in the home.”

Like other companies built on solving for a shift to more remote and virtual care options, Cheek said that Everlywell had already anticipated this kind of consumer demand — but COVID-19 has dramatically accelerated the pace of change, which is why the startup put together this round, at this size, this quickly (she says they started the process of putting together the Series D in September).

“We’ve been talking about the digital health movement, and the consumer-directed movement probably for a decade now,” she told me. “I do believe that this will be the watershed moment, unfortunately. But hopefully, we will come out on the other side of the pandemic and say, ‘There are some good things that happened broadly for healthcare.’ That is the hope of what we lean into everyday, and fundamentally, why we went out and raised this amount of capital in this tremendous growth year.”

Image Credits: Everlywell

Everlywell has also expanded availability of its products this year, with distribution in more than 10,000 retail locations across Target, Walgreens, CVS and Kroger stores across the U.S. The company also landed a number of new partnerships on the diagnostic lab and insurance payer side, as well as with major employers — a key customer group as employers shoulder the largest share of healthcare spending in the U.S. due to employee benefit plans. Cheek says that despite their commercial and enterprise customer wins, the focus remains squarely on consumer satisfaction, which is what distinguishes their offering.

“Our COVID-19 test is 75% new people buying our product, and it has an NPS [net promoter score] of 75,” she said. “And then it’s the most highly referred product, and also one of our top tests where people buy other tests. Experience matters here — we know that if someone is a promoter of Everlywell, if they rate us a nine or a 10, on NPS, they are five times more likely to purchase again on the platform.”

That’s not new for Everlywell, according to Cheek — customers have always had a high degree of satisfaction with the company’s products. But what is new is the expanded reach, and the realization among many Americans that virtual care and at-home options are available, and are effective.

“What you have is this lightbulb moment for Americans in a new way that care can be delivered where then they definitely don’t want to go back,” she said. “It’s not just for Everlywell. This is all of these verticals, that have really shifted consumer behavior around healthcare in the home, and I think that will be somewhat permanent. That is the main driver here, and is what we’re seeing, and it’s why Everlywell has resonated so well with so many Americans.”

Carbon Health to launch 100 pop-up COVID-19 testing clinics across the US

Primary care health tech startup Carbon Health has added a new element to its “omnichannel” healthcare approach with the launch of a new pop-up clinic model that is already live in San Francisco, LA, Seattle, Brooklyn and Manhattan, with Detroit to follow soon – and that will be rolling out over the next weeks and months across a variety of major markets in the U.S., ultimately resulting in 100 new COVID-19 testing sites that will add testing capacity on the order of around an additional 100,000 patients per month across the country.

So far, Carbon Health has focused its COVID-19 efforts around its existing facilities in the Bay Area, and also around pop-up testing sites set up in and around San Francisco through collaboration with genomics startup Color, and municipal authorities. Now, Carbon Health CEO and co-founder Even Bali tells me in an interview that the company believes the time is right for it to take what it has learned and apply that on a more national scale, with a model that allows for flexible and rapid deployment. In fact, Bali says the they realized and began working towards this goal as early as March.

“We started working on COVID response as early as February, because we were seeing patients who are literally coming from Wuhan, China to our clinics,” Bali said. “We expected the pandemic to hit any time. And partially because of the failure of federal government control, we decided to do everything we can to be able to help out with certain things.”

That began with things that Carbon could do locally, more close to home in its existing footprint. But it was obvious early on to Bali and his team that there would be a need to scale efforts more broadly. To do that, Carbon was able to draw on its early experience.

“We have been doing on-site, we have been going to nursing homes, we have been working with companies to help them reopen,” he told me. “At this point, I think we’ve done more than 200,000 COVID tests by ourselves. And I think I do more than half of all the Bay Area, if you include that the San Francisco City initiative is also partly powered by Carbon Health, so we’re already trying to scale as much as possible, but at some point we were hitting some physical space limits, and had the idea back in March to scale with more pop-up, more mobile clinics that you can actually put up like faster than a physical location.”

Interior of one of Carbon Health’s COVID-19 testing pop-up clinics in Brooklyn.

To this end, Carbon Health also began using a mobile trailer that would travel from town to town in order to provide testing to communities that weren’t typically well-served. That ended up being a kind of prototype of this model, which employs construction trailers like you’d see at a new condo under development acting as a foreman’s office, but refurbished and equipped with everything needed for on-site COVID testing run by medical professionals. These, too, are a more temporary solution, as Carbon Health is working with a manufacturing company to create a more fit-for-purpose custom design that can be manufactured at scale to help them ramp deployment of these even faster.

Carbon Health is partnering with Reef Technologies, a SoftBank -backed startup that turns parking garage spots into locations for businesses, including foodservice, fulfilment, and now Carbon’s medical clinics. This has helped immensely with the complications of local permitting and real estate regulations, Bali says. That means that Carbon Health’s pop-up clinics can bypass a lot of the red tape that slows the process of opening more traditional, permanent locations.

While cost is one advantage of using this model, Bali says that actually it’s not nearly as inexpensive as you might think relative to opening a more traditional clinic – at least until their custom manufacturing and economies of scale kick in. But speed is the big advantage, and that’s what is helping Carbon Health look ahead from this particular moment, to how these might be used either post-pandemic, or during the eventual vaccine distribution phase of the COVID crisis. Bali points out that any approved vaccine will need administration to patients, which will require as much, if not more infrastructure than testing.

Exterior of one of Carbon Health’s COVID-19 testing pop-up clinics in Brooklyn.

Meanwhile, Carbon Health’s pop-up model could bridge the gap between traditional primary care and telehealth, for ongoing care needs unrelated to COVID.

“A lot of the problems that telemedicine is not a good solution for, are the things where a video check-in with a doctor is nearly enough, but you do need some diagnostic tests – maybe you might you may need some administration, or you may need like a really simple physical examination that nursing staff can do with the instructions of the doctor. So if you think about those cases, pretty much 90% of all visits can actually be done with a doctor on video, and nursing staff in person.”

COVID testing is an imminent, important need nationwide – and COVID vaccine administration will hopefully soon replace it, with just as much urgency. But even after the pandemic has passed, healthcare in general will change dramatically, and Carbon Health’s model could be a more permanent and scalable way to address the needs of distributed care everywhere.

This Labor Day, spare a thought for the workers who made your doorstep delivery possible

Arjuna Costa
Contributor

Arjuna Costa is a partner at Omidyar Network and early stage investor in Ruma.

A few weeks ago, I bought a used paperback mystery for $3 via a small online bookseller. Intrigued that the book came with free shipping, I dug in a bit and was shocked to see that my little impulse purchase traveled through seven different distribution hubs across five states before it got to me. It was loaded and unloaded onto trucks in Indiana, Illinois, Colorado, Nevada and finally California and handled by an unknown number of logistics workers along the way, many of them in the middle of the night.

The logistics of getting the book to me, and the human toll it takes, are mind boggling, but we have become somewhat inured to them.

COVID-19 lockdowns have put a spotlight on the importance and complexity of supply chain dynamics. In a world shaped by the pandemic, our reliance on e-commerce for everything from PPE to toilet paper to hard-boiled paperback mysteries has exploded. A recent report from Adobe found that total online spending is up 77% year-over-year, accelerating growth by “four to six years.” That growth has a very real human cost, and one that we don’t think about or act on enough as a society.

While people recognize the contributions of frontline workers they can see like doctors and nurses, postal carriers and grocery store workers, there’s an entire hidden infrastructure of logistics workers that keeps the online economy humming. These workers are also on the frontlines, but they are behind the scenes. Most earn minimum wage and work long, grueling, high-stress shifts without strong protections in the event they get sick or injured. The fact is that many corporations haven’t made protections for those workers a priority. That was true before COVID-19, but the pandemic gave the issue a renewed urgency, prompting workers from Amazon, Walmart, Target and FedEx, among others, to organize walkouts. And with unprecedented levels of unemployment, more and more people are going to find jobs in the logistics sector.

This Labor Day, it’s time to think about how corporations can better support and protect this vital but often forgotten segment of the workforce.

Better safety in the warehouse

Imagine there’s a package handler at a major manufacturer named Jack who spends his shifts heaving heavy boxes onto a conveyor belt. It’s an arduous movement that Jack will repeat a few thousand times before he punches out. As a 10-year veteran on the job, Jack has performed this singular task on this same warehouse floor more times than he can count. On this particular night, he’s tired after staying up late playing with his kids, and he slips a disk in his back. Unfortunately, Jack’s plight is all too often a reality for millions of workers today.

According to the Bureau of Labor Statistics, 5% of warehouse workers in the U.S. experience an injury on the job each year—higher than the national average. After service workers, like firefighters and police, transportation/shipping and manufacturing/production rank second and third as the occupations with the largest number of workplace injuries resulting in days away from work. Jobs that involve heavy lifting, arduous repetition and operating complex machinery come with serious risk.

Injuries can be devastating for workers, both physically and financially. Taking time off work can not only result in lost wages, but also drive people into debt due to health-related expenses, creating health-poverty traps that are difficult to climb out of. Worker injuries are also costly for employers. A study from Liberty Mutual, using data from the U.S. Bureau of Labor Statistics and the National Academy of Social Insurance, found that serious, nonfatal injuries cost $84.04 million a week in the transportation and warehousing industry. It is in corporations’ best interest to prioritize workplace safety.

One challenge is that traditional approaches to workplace safety are slow, inaccurate and costly. Without practical interventions, organizations spend an estimated $2,000+ per worker annually on injury prevention. Within manufacturing and logistics industries, it costs an additional $2,000+ annually for workers’ compensation per full-time employee. Currently, there is no standard solution to preventing workplace injuries while lowering costs, leaving workers like Jack without adequate protections. Fortunately, digital platforms and tools that leverage technological innovation, including sensors and wearables, are advancing new ways to prevent workplace accidents and injuries.

Take for example StrongArm, one of Flourish’s portfolio companies. StrongArm has built a technology platform that integrates a new generation of industrial wearables, big data analytics and smart algorithms. It is designed to modernize industry dynamics for workers, employers and workers’ compensation insurers. The company’s GDPR-compliant wearable hardware devices and data platform called FUSE deliver real-time injury prevention feedback and collect data to support precise interventions for overall injury reduction and has reduced injury rates by more than 40% year-over-year for its clients.

StrongArm has also helped keep workers safe during the pandemic by launching a new suite of capabilities on its FUSE platform, including CDC communication, proximity alerts (i.e., notifications to workers within six feet of one another), and exposure analysis (understanding who has interacted with whom, at what time, and for what duration, exposing any potential contact transfer with accuracy). These enhanced capabilities can get workers back to work faster, earning vitally needed income while reducing COVID-19 risk by 95%.

Fetch Robotics is another company using technological innovation and digital platforms to promote worker safety. Fetch makes an Autonomous Mobile Robot (AMR) that can transport materials within warehouses, factories and distribution centers while also gathering environmental data. This can relieve the burden of heavy lifting from human workers and ensure that conditions, like heat, remain safe in work environments. In June 2020, the company announced that it was launching a disinfecting AMR that can decontaminate spaces larger than 100,000 square feet in 1.5 hours, helping workers stay safe and get back to work quicker amid the spread of the virus.

Employers should do more

In its report titled, “The Impact of COVID-19 on Tech Innovation,” Lux Research found that the outbreak of COVID-19 will likely push corporations with major manufacturing and logistics operations to assess the potential of robotics. More companies will explore how they can automate processes, particularly those that are repeatable and predictable. Findings like these inevitably lead to questions about how increased automation will impact workers — the eternal “will robots take all the jobs?” question. However, we are still a long way away from a world where human workers are obsolete (just ask Elon Musk).

Robots are still not good at picking up small or oddly shaped objects, for instance. For the foreseeable future, corporations will depend on logistics workers and have a responsibility to protect the safety of those workers. It’s not enough to plaster the required OSHA sign on the factory or warehouse floor. Corporations need to do more. Fortunately in this case, the right thing to do is the good thing to do. By embracing technological innovation, promoting worker safety is a win-win.

When someone great is gone: How to address grief in the workplace with empathy

Tamar Lucien
Contributor

Tamar Lucien is CEO of MentalHappy, lives in the Bay Area and enjoys spending time hiking, cooking new vegetarian recipes, meditating and dancing to 90’s music!

Birthday cakes, gift cards, free lunches, snacks, movie tickets, and other perks are generously bestowed on employees to celebrate life’s happy moments. This is an improvement from the industrial approach to management, but can we go deeper for our work-family members?

Life’s darker moments hold the greatest opportunity to exemplify a genuine and caring 21st-century workplace culture. One which fosters empathy and camaraderie. Employee turnover is highest when employees take leave, claim FMLA, or use PTO. According to Global Studies, 79% of employees report their reason for quitting was simply due to feeling unnoticed (lack of appreciation).

Appreciation for your employees is best demonstrated as an act of kindness in moments that really matter, like the loss of a family member. Acknowledging that someone great is gone, instead of ignoring the uncomfortable aspects of grief, is a valuable way to embed empathy into your workplace culture.

Recently, while working with a mid-sized (500+ employees) tech company, I asked what they were doing to support employees during the negative life moments. The HR Director replied, “um, nothing really”.

Once realizing how crappy that sounded, another executive countered her by saying he sent an employee a t-shirt and card after a miscarriage. I later learned that the employee he was referring to had been with the company for over 5 years, so it’s safe to assume that she had a couple of company swag t-shirts in her collection prior to getting one as a get well gift.

Even in the largest and most notable companies, where a variety of employee amenities and benefits are offered, the concept and practice of empathy is often neglected. Perhaps you haven’t come across such extreme examples of indifference in your workplace, but you may have participated in signing a generic condolences card or chipping in for some flowers.
